Concrete AI Opportunities with ROI Framing

1. Automating the IT Service Desk: A significant portion of revenue and cost for IT services firms is tied to service desk operations. Implementing AI-powered virtual agents and intelligent ticket routing can automate 30-40% of tier-1 requests. The ROI is clear: reduced labor costs per ticket, improved technician utilization for complex issues, and higher client satisfaction due to faster resolution times. This investment can pay for itself within 12-18 months through direct operational savings.

2. Proactive Infrastructure Management: Moving from reactive break-fix support to predictive maintenance is a major value proposition. By applying machine learning to client monitoring data (logs, performance metrics), Lucas can predict system failures or performance bottlenecks before they cause business disruption. This allows for scheduled, off-peak maintenance, drastically reducing costly emergency outages for clients. The ROI manifests as the ability to command premium service contracts, reduce penalty payouts for SLA breaches, and deepen strategic client relationships.

3. Accelerating Custom Development: For its software development and integration projects, Lucas can embed AI coding assistants into its developers' workflows. These tools can accelerate code generation, automate testing, and improve code quality. The ROI is measured in increased developer productivity (potentially 20-30%), faster project delivery times, and reduced bug-fix cycles post-deployment. This directly improves project margins and allows the company to take on more work with the same-sized team.

Deployment Risks Specific to a 1001-5000 Employee Company

For a company of Lucas's size, AI deployment carries distinct risks. First is integration complexity. The firm likely has a heterogeneous tech stack accumulated over years, serving diverse clients. Integrating new AI tools seamlessly across this landscape without disrupting ongoing service delivery is a major challenge. Second is talent and cost. Building an in-house AI competency requires significant investment in recruiting data scientists and ML engineers, who are expensive and in high demand. The upfront costs for software, infrastructure, and training can be substantial for a mid-market firm. Third is data governance and security. As an IT services provider handling sensitive client data, any AI initiative must have robust data isolation, privacy, and security protocols from the outset. A single breach or compliance failure could irreparably damage client trust. A phased, use-case-led approach, starting with a pilot in a controlled environment, is essential to mitigate these risks while demonstrating value.

Why should a mid-size IT services company invest in AI now?
AI is becoming a table-stakes differentiator. Early adoption allows Lucas to build internal expertise, improve margins through automation, and offer cutting-edge AI-enhanced services to clients before competitors do.
What are the biggest risks in deploying AI at this scale?
Key risks include integrating AI with legacy client systems, ensuring data security and privacy across multiple client environments, and the upfront cost and talent acquisition required for a successful implementation.
Which AI use case has the fastest ROI?
AI for the IT service desk typically shows rapid ROI by directly reducing labor costs per ticket and improving client satisfaction scores through faster, more accurate first-contact resolution.
How can we start without a large data science team?
Begin by leveraging managed AI services and pre-built SaaS platforms (e.g., for chat or analytics) that require less customization. Focus initially on a single, high-impact process like ticket routing to build experience.
